tworzenie macierzy na podstawie ilości elementów, które ma zawierać

0

Załóżmy, że mamy stworzyć macierz, która zawiera n elementów, np. wiemy, że n = 20. Macierz powinna mieć wymiary najbardziej zbliżone do kwadratowej czyli w powyższym przypadku 4 x 5 lub 5 x 4. Liczba n, którą znamy, nie jest liczbą pierwszą, bo to nie pozwoliłoby na utworzenie jakiejkolwiek macierzy. Jak obliczyć ilość wierszy i kolumn znając n ?

0

zanaleźć wszystkie dzielniki tej liczby i wziąć 2 dzielniki o numerach w tablicy je zawierającej (vector) gdzie pierwszy to numer_pierwszego_dzielnika+n, a drugi numer_ostatniego_dzielnika-n
n = dowolna liczba z przedziału <1, ilosc_dzielników>

0

Obliczyć pierwiastek kwadratowy z n, wybrać najbliższą do niego liczbę całkowitą i podzielić przez nią n.

1 użytkowników online, w tym zalogowanych: 0, gości: 1